Gokak Falls

Horseshoe cataract with a century-old hanging bridge at its crest

Gokak Falls season by season

Winter December to February Quiet, but open

Dec-Feb the Ghataprabha thins to streaks down the red horseshoe cliff; pleasant 29 °C walking weather, but you came for water.

Summer March to May Do not go

Mar-May is bare rock in 40 °C north Karnataka heat, the falls dry unless Hidkal dam releases upstream; skip it.

Monsoon June to September Prime time

Jul-Sep is the event: a curtain nearly 170 m wide in full roar; the hanging bridge often shuts at peak flow, so you watch from the banks

Autumn October to November Prime time

October usually still carries dam-fed flow, with softer light on the Chalukyan temple at the brink; November is a gamble.

What Gokak Falls is actually like

Local families and photographers in season, nobody after; sleep in Gokak town 6 km away or day-trip from Belagavi.

Getting to Gokak Falls

Ghataprabha railhead 12 km, Belagavi airport 70 km; buses to Gokak town, then an auto 6 km out to the falls.
